Obama on Health Care Passage

Say what you want about the merits of this legislation (it’s a huge step in the right direction, but a long way from being perfect), but it strikes me as insane that a politician put his entire reputation on the line and came through.  When was the last time that happened?

And as much as she’s been demonized from the Fox News crowd, if you supported the passage of this legislation then you’ve got to give credit to Nancy Pelosi.  Without her balls/chutzpah/stone cold assassin demeanor this wouldn’t have gotten done.  I mean, remember when Scott Brown won the Massachusetts special election and everyone pretty much said this was dead in the water?  Yeah, it’s because of Pelosi.

